[Paraduodenal internal hernias: clinical analysis of two cases].

Meral Sen1, Aydin Inan, Cenap Dener, Mikdat Bozer.   

Abstract

Paraduodenal hernias, or so called "congenital intraperitoneal hernias"are rare cause intestinal obstruction. These hernias are caused by variations in intestinal rotation and the patients present with symptoms ranging from intermittent abdominal pain to acute obstruction. We report two cases of obstructive paraduodenal hernias which are at left and right each and review of its clinical features and surgical management.
